![]() |
發(fā)布時間: 2022-12-5 19:19
正文摘要:1.將輸入的同頻率的采樣電壓、采樣電流信號整定成為方波信號,這兩個方波信號,送到D觸發(fā)器。若電壓超前電流,則C為邏輯“0”;若電流超前電壓,則C為邏輯“1” 問題①-----D觸發(fā)器是如何判斷電壓和電流的相位關 ... |
yzwzfyz 發(fā)表于 2022-12-7 16:59 很抽象 你有水平 但是感覺說得不通俗 |
coody_sz 發(fā)表于 2022-12-5 23:36 ADC采集什么???我不知道你DFT是什么含義 傅里葉?具體怎么實現(xiàn)你知道嗎 |
coody_sz 發(fā)表于 2022-12-5 23:36 是M級別的 比如5M的信號 |
Hephaestus 發(fā)表于 2022-12-5 23:02 負載是換能器 |
coody_sz 發(fā)表于 2022-12-5 23:36 ADC可以算出來相位? |
前提:先將兩個信號處理成對稱方波A、B,即正負各占50%。 問題①:一個方波A做D觸發(fā)器的CLK,在它的上沿采樣另一個方波B,如果同相,理論上D的狀態(tài)也在B的上沿上,0?1?不確定,但只要B向前或后挪動一點,只1、0是確定了。 問題②:兩個相同周期的對稱方波相與,輸出必是0-50%上面已分析,甚至給出或門時為50-100%。 問題③:用單片機做個周期與脈寬的比較即可。 問題④:與門很關鍵,輸出的正脈沖寬度與周期比,就是相差。 問題⑤:這個太初級,不講了。感壓前流后,容壓后流前。 |
1、信號A是CLK,信號B是D,由于周期一樣,則CLK上沿出現(xiàn)時,D的正負就決定了兩者的超前與遲后的關系。為個不難理解。想像一下:同相時,D在CLK上沿是0是1?向前、向后挪一點呢? 2、兩個信號相與,有0出0,當相差180時,不是A=0,就是B=0,與門輸出為0。當相差0時,A、B同0同1,同1時與門出1,同0時與門同0,輸出各占50%的空間。所以,從同相到相差180度,與門輸出脈寬是50%-0%。其實用或門也可以,只不過輸出是從50%-100%。 所以,根據與門輸出的脈沖占空比就可以算出兩者的相差了。 |
不用那么麻煩吧?如果頻率不是很高,比如1000Hz一下,將電壓電流做ADC就可以輕松計算出來,比如用哪個DFT方式。 |
問題①②③④,根據波形圖和原理圖很容易看出來,總不能讓我把與門的真值表也畫給你吧,這樣子干脆把《數字電路》這本書全都抄寫到這個帖子里面算了。 問題⑤取決于你的負載特性,你都不說負載是什么。 |